Medicare Principles Explained

Original Medicare is provided by the US authorities to folks who are over age 65 or under 65 and on disability. Medicare is made up of Parts A and B. Part A covers hospital insurance and Part B covers doctor visits and outpatient services. Normally, Medicare covers 80% of the bill so there is 20% left along with many deductibles copays and coinsurances. Because of these openings left over many people decide to acquire a Medicare Supplement Plan to pay what Medicare does not fully cover, these plans are also known as Medigap plans.

Medicare Supplement Outline

There are 10 standardized Medicare supplement plans available. The hottest Medicare supplement plans are programs F, G, & N. Since the programs are all standardized and the benefits are regulated by the US government there is no difference in coverage between carriers for the exact same plan. For instance, Plan G is precisely the same whether it is offered by Mutual of Omaha, Aetna, Cigna, or some other company. In any given condition in the U.S. there are approximately 30 or more carriers offering these plans, each in a different premium.

With any standardized Medigap plan you are able to see any doctor anywhere in the country that accepts Medicare, no referrals needed. Also plans F, G and N have a limited foreign travel coverage that’s beneficial for all those folks May traveling beyond the country.

Also, it’s essential to be aware that prescription coverage isn’t offered on any standardized Medicare Supplement Plan, it is covered under a separate plan referred to as part D.

These plans are also guaranteed-renewable for life, premiums can’t be increased due to health or canceled due to health.

Medigap Plan F

Medicare Supplement Plan F is most comprehensive of Medicare supplement plans and also the priciest. Coverage is fairly straightforward, this program covers everything Medicare does not totally pay, such as the 20 percent and all deductibles copays and coinsurances. With a option F, you shouldn’t ever have a health bill, provided that the services you receive are accepted by Medicare.

Medigap Plan G

Medicare supplement program G is the most popular plan option in 2021. Medigap plan G is thought to be the most cost-effective plan when compared using the other Medicare supplement programs available. This plan option is very similar to Plan F, it covers 100 percent of all except for the part B deductible that is not insured and that allowance is $203 in 2021.

The reason plan G is considered the most cost-effective option is because when compared against Plan F, the sum of money you save in high is more than the benefit difference, which can be (amount) in (year). Additionally, the rate increases on average, historically are somewhat less on Plan G than on Plan F. Additionally, Plan F is not going to be provided following 2022 to people turning 65 and that will most likely cause the prices to go up more than they’ve gone up in the past. Another reason Plan G a better long-term option.

Supplemental Medigap Plan N

Medicare Supplement Plan N is the most economical of the three . Plan N is comparable to insurance plan G, except the next out-of-pocket expenditures on insurance N:

$0-$20 office visit copay
$50 at the emergency room (waived if admitted)
Part B excess charges are not covered

Plan N is a potential great match for someone who doesn’t see the physician on a regular basis, this individual wouldn’t incur the office visit copay each time they visit the doctor. If you’re wanting to save a little premium dollars Plan N can be a fantastic fit for you.
